We set up a test zap for our SaaS app. We created a private integration and added a webhook from our CRM system. We selected QuickBooks as an APP and used the create invoice zap. The idea being to send a new invoice from our CRM to QB.
This all worked great. We used the create/find customer zap for QB, but this is where we have an issue.
If the customer from our CRM is NOT in QB the create customer in QB fails with this error:
QuickBooks Online: A business validation error has occurred while processing your request
For the create customer - we have checked as follows
Email is an email and validates - not used in QB
Name looks good.
We have tried removing all fields down to just an email but it still fails on the create customer step in QB
Since we get know error or debug log impossible to figure out what is wrong?